How long are you staying? On Sunday, the only one I know for sure is running the double deckers is the Oyster Bay line that you can take from Jamaica. During the Weekdays, there are a few more that you can pick. BTW if you're near the NY area and you like double deckers, NJ Transit also has double deckers, and they're even less predictable.

Oyster Bay has the added benefit that there is a small railroad museum there and also has a beach, though the beach is not that great.

Also, a bit further out in Long Island, is the Long Island Steamers which your kids will surely enjoy, and tomorrow happens to be a run day. http://longislandlivesteamers.org/index.php

Also, regarding LIRR Double Deckers, any train going to Montauk (or any other unelectrified line) are double deckers.
